Transaction

abcbe0842f621ee2132e239897234d6337c30d8749d732c51439bac901cc25dd

Summary

In Block1421591
TimeMon, 22 Oct 2018 12:26:08 UTC
Total Input1789.3052836 PIV
Total Output1789.3042836 PIV
Fees0.001 PIV

Details

Raw Transaction